[HTML][HTML] Intercellular adhesion molecule-1 (ICAM-1) regulates endothelial cell motility through a nitric oxide-dependent pathway
Coordinated regulation of endothelial cell migration is an integral process during
angiogenesis. However, molecular mechanisms regulating endothelial cell migration remain
largely unknown. Increased expression of cell adhesion molecules has been implicated
during angiogenesis, yet the precise role of these molecules is unclear. Here, we examined
the hypothesis that intercellular adhesion molecule-1 (ICAM-1) is important for endothelial
cell migration. Total cell displacement and directional migration were significantly attenuated …
